WebSpecial resolutions are required to pass important motions affecting the Body Corporate. These include improvements to common property costing more than $2000 per lot and changes or additions to the body corporate by-laws which require consent to record a new community management statement.

WebMar 23, 2024 · The body corporate must determine such amounts to be raised and then raise and collect the amounts by levying contributions on the owners. These contributions become due when the trustees pass a resolution to that effect in terms of section 3 (2) and (3) of the STSM Act.
